What Are Beauty Supplements?
Beauty supplements are oral products designed to enhance your appearance from the inside out. They often contain a mix of vitamins, minerals, amino acids, or botanical ingredients that contribute to the health of skin, hair, and nails. For example, supplements with biotin, vitamin C, and collagen are popular, as they play roles in maintaining skin elasticity and hair strength. Using these can support your natural beauty by providing essential nutrients that may be lacking in your diet.

How Do Beauty Supplements Work?
Nourishing From Within
Most beauty supplements aim to nourish the body from within, filling nutritional gaps that could impact your appearance. Vitamins like A, C, and E are powerful antioxidants that protect skin cells from damage by free radicals. Collagen, the protein responsible for skin elasticity, can help reduce wrinkles and improve skin hydration when taken orally.
Targeting Specific Concerns
Different supplements target specific beauty concerns. For instance, a supplement focused on hair health might include keratin and zinc, both crucial for preventing hair loss and promoting growth. Nail health supplements often contain high levels of biotin to strengthen and reduce brittleness.

Choosing the Right Beauty Supplement
Determining Your Needs
Before selecting a beauty supplement, identify your specific needs. Are you aiming to improve skin elasticity, strengthen hair, or combat nail brittleness? Consider consulting with a healthcare professional to tailor the supplement intake to your needs, ensuring safety and effectiveness.
Check for Quality and Safety
Always choose supplements from reputable brands that provide transparency regarding their ingredients and manufacturing processes. Look for third-party testing and certifications to ensure the product’s safety and potency.

FAQs
Are beauty supplements safe to use every day?
Most beauty supplements are safe for daily use as long as you’re following the recommended dosage. However, it’s essential to consult with a healthcare professional, especially if you have existing health conditions.
Do beauty supplements replace skincare products?
Supplements are meant to complement, not replace, topical skincare products. They work best when used alongside a balanced diet and a consistent skincare routine.
How long does it take to see results?
Results can vary depending on the individual and the specific supplement used, but most people notice improvements within a few weeks to a month of consistent use.
Can I take multiple beauty supplements at once?
While it’s possible to take multiple supplements, be cautious of overlapping ingredients that could lead to excessive nutrient intake. Again, consult with a healthcare professional to balance supplement intake effectively.
What are the side effects of beauty supplements?
Potential side effects are generally mild and can include digestive discomfort or allergic reactions depending on individual sensitivities. Always read labels carefully and follow the recommended dosage.
